Agile ways are now key in making mobile projects work well, with 71% of places using Agile sometimes. At Sidekick Interactive, these ways are used not just in making things but also in getting the right people and managing the work.

Agile is all about working together, changing when needed, and teams sorting things out themselves. This matters a lot in mobile work, where what you need to do can change as new things are found. Agile teams don’t stick to strict plans. They use feedback all the time to change fast and do well.

"This way of thinking about projects and work is inclusive, focusing on the input of individuals, teams, and customers to get constant feedback as projects are developed. That means quicker reactions to change and faster delivery to customers. It’s modernizing project management to focus on the right things at the right time. There is an increased emphasis on efficiency, waste elimination, and a focus on the end users." – Samantha Kaplan, Director of Quality & Continuous Improvement – Client Solutions and Program Management at Corporate College

Every day, short team chats help all stay on the same page and fix issues fast. Short work cycles allow teams to learn and get better with each sprint, and different experts work as one from the start. This cuts back on wait times and gaps in info that often happen in old ways of working.

Making mobile apps often needs following strict rules, mostly in areas like health and money. Sidekick Interactive uses tools to check that projects keep up with these rules and still work great during and after making.

Watching how an app does is key, as 72% of people drop an app if it bugs them in the first 10 seconds. Even a crash rate of just 1% can lead to 100 bad times per 10,000 uses. To fix these problems, Sidekick Interactive keeps an eye on apps all the time. They have a security list to stop crashes and data issues, and they check crash reports every week to find issues fast.

"Maintenance isn’t just about ‘keeping it running’ – it’s about keeping it maintainable." – Liam Coughlin, Co-founder & Software Architect at Sidekick Interactive

Tracking tools look at how real users act to find and fix slow spots and rank what needs updating. This is key for healthcare apps, since 63% don’t meet user hopes after they go live. By making sure apps stay fast and safe as systems change, these tools are crucial for keeping them good over time.

Think About What Your Project Needs

Before you team up with a staffing agency, look hard at what your work asks for. If it’s tough to find people with the skills you need, you might need specialized help. Ask:

  • Does your work use new tech like 3D scans, Vision Pro, or added reality?
  • Must you follow strict rules in areas like health or money?
  • Do you need to grow your team fast?

Look at UC Davis Health System. They badly needed skilled people, so they used a specialized staffing agency and got good folks in a week – a speed not easy with usual ways.

Also, workers leaving can cost firms a lot – 16% to 20% of the worker’s pay. If your work has hard tech needs, these costs and the struggle to find the right skills make a specialized agency a wise pick.
